Colorado, Air Force Notes
November 23, 2011 | Men's Basketball
TEAM
- First road win this season in first true road game.
- Improves to 18-3 all-time against Air Force, including 9-2 at AFA.
- CU has won the last two in a row against the Falcons, both at Clune Arena.
- Coach Boyle evens his all-time record against the Falcons, 2-2.
- First overtime game of the series
- Buffs have won two-straight games this season and improves 3-2 and hosts Georgia, Monday, Nov. 28 on FSN national.
- CU has won 25-straight non-conference home games.
- Improves to 2-1 when leading at the half.
- Shot a season-best (first-half) from the field (53.8%).
- Made a season-high six treys in the first half.
NATE TOMLINSON
- made four, three-pointers (three in first half). Fourth game to make at least one three-pointer; 7 treys in the last two games.
- moved into ninth place on the CU's all-time three-point list (121) passing Chauncey Billups (1995-97) 120.
- scored a career-first half best 16 points in the first half
ANDRE ROBERSON
• recorded his fourth double-digit rebound game of the season (16 career).
- Grabbed 13 rebounds (57) to give him 354 career rebounds moving into 50th place on the career list at CU.
- recorded his eighth career double-double
AUSTIN DUFAULT
- 99th career start (105th career game)
- Netted double-digits fourth time this season (31st career)
CARLON BROWN
- Scored 16 points, fifth time this season in double digits.
